4. Pureit Advanced UV Water Purifier
Technology: UV purification
Capacity: 5 liters
Best For: Areas with low TDS tap water
Pros:
No wastage of water
Affordable and compact
Cons:
Doesn’t remove dissolved salts or heavy metals

H2: Maintenance and Replacement
Regular filter replacement (3–12 months)
Check UV lamps and RO membranes
Annual servicing recommended

2. Do I need electricity for UV or RO purifiers?
Yes, both require electricity to operate.
3. Can I install a water purifier myself?
Some UV systems are DIY, but RO systems should be installed by professionals.
4. How often should I change filters?
Typically every 6–12 months, depending on usage and water quality.
